Industrial CT refers to industrial computed tomography imaging, which can clearly, accurately and intuitively display the internal structure, composition, Material and defect condition. The basic principle is based on the attenuation and absorption characteristics of radiation in the detected object. The absorption capacity of the same substance to radiation is related to the properties of the substance. Therefore, using the X-rays or γ-rays with a certain energy and intensity emitted by radionuclides or other radiation sources, the attenuation law and distribution in the detected object, it is possible to obtain detailed information inside the object from the detector array. The information is then displayed in the form of images using computer information processing and image reconstruction techniques.

Industrial CT has powerful advantages:

▲Accurate positioning, the image is easier to identify

Conventional ray detection technology mainly projects a three-dimensional object onto a two-dimensional plane, which is easy to cause the superposition of image information. If you want to obtain the information on the image, it is very difficult to accurately locate and quantitatively measure the target without experience. When detecting the workpiece, it can give two-dimensional or three-dimensional images, the target to be measured will not be blocked by the surrounding details, and the obtained image is very easy to identify. The specific spatial position, shape and size information of the target feature can be directly obtained from the image.


▲Higher density resolution

It has outstanding density resolution capability, and the density resolution of high-quality CT images can even reach 0.3%, which is at least an order of magnitude higher than that of conventional non-destructive testing techniques.


▲High dynamic response range

Using high-performance detectors, the dynamic response range of the detectors can reach more than 106, which is much higher than that of film and image intensifiers.


▲Images are easier to store, transmit, analyze and process

Due to the intuitive image, the grayscale of the image corresponds to the material, geometric structure, composition and density characteristics of the workpiece, not only the shape, position and size of the defect can be obtained, but also the nature of the defect can be determined by combining the density analysis technology, so that the long-term There is a more direct solution to the problems of spatial positioning of defects, depth quantification and comprehensive qualitative problems that have plagued non-destructive testing personnel.
